International Conference Influence on Elections
The effect of global summits on national voting cannot be understated. In an age where international relations increasingly affects domestic agendas, leaders often find themselves at the crossroads of international discussions and local electoral mandates. Summits provide a venue for heads of state to negotiate treaties, advance cooperation, and confront urgent global issues, and these results frequently resonate with the electorate back home. Consequently, the choices made during these high-stakes meetings can heavily sway public opinion and shape the course of political campaigns.
Additionally, global summits often serve as a vital forum for diplomatic negotiations, which can alter the governing landscape of nations. When leaders gather to resolve conflicts or form alliances, the results can lead to a heightened sense of stability that resonates with voters. On the flip side, unsuccessful negotiations or international rifts can intensify nationalistic sentiments and provoke skepticism towards political candidates, especially those whose policies are tied to international relations. Such dynamics create a distinct interplay where the results of global discussions directly affect election strategies and voter behavior.
Moreover, the press attention surrounding these conferences plays a key role in shaping public opinion. As politicians engage in international dialogues, the attention of their actions can push specific issues to the forefront of national discussions. This spotlight can amplify the significance of international policy in election platforms, prompting candidates to articulate their standpoints on international affairs in ways that resonate to an increasingly interconnected electorate. Consequently, the impact of global summit results can be felt in local elections, showing the profound influence of global politics on domestic governance.
Foreign Policy and Democratic Processes
The interaction between foreign policy and democracy has become more important in today’s global world. As nations engage in diplomatic summits, they often emphasize the promotion of democratic values and human rights as foundational elements of their diplomatic initiatives. These discussions frequently lead to collaborative initiatives aimed at fostering effective governance in countries facing crises. Consequently, states are finding that their diplomatic choices are linked with the state of democratic governance not only inside their own territories but also in regions they seek to affect.
Moreover, global negotiations offer another venue where principles of democracy can shape international diplomacy. When adversarial groups come together to discuss, there is a heightened opportunity for advocates of democracy to advocate governance changes and electoral processes that reflect the will of the people. By embedding democratic values into treaties, nations can facilitate a smoother transition from conflict to peaceful rule, thereby reducing the likelihood of future unrest. This supports the idea that lasting peace is often built on a foundation of a robust and inclusive democratic system.
Lastly, the global nature of political engagement has prompted countries to reassess their diplomatic approaches. As people around the world exercise their right to participate in elections and be involved in government, there is an increasing demand for governments to back these movements actively. Foreign initiatives now often include pledges to aid in democratic institution-building and electoral support. This change highlights the importance of democracy as a fundamental element of international relations, indicating that diplomatic strategy is no longer just about national interests but also about the global commitment to maintain principles of democracy.
